# Clothing-System-3D **Repository Path**: qingjun1991/Clothing-System-3D ## Basic Information - **Project Name**: Clothing-System-3D - **Description**: No description available - **Primary Language**: Unknown - **License**: MIT - **Default Branch**: master - **Homepage**: None - **GVP Project**: No ## Statistics - **Stars**: 0 - **Forks**: 0 - **Created**: 2020-03-13 - **Last Updated**: 2020-12-19 ## Categories & Tags **Categories**: Uncategorized **Tags**: None ## README # Clothing System 3D This is an asset project for Unity 3D that allows customization of a characters appearance. Work in progress. This project can be used as a base for your own asset. It is a full functionally asset but can require modifications to match your project needs. No version for mobiles. Read the **Documentation** to learn how to use the asset. **Unity version and language** The actual version of Unity used in this project is 5.4.1f1, and the language used is C#. **Note: Only for desktop (Windows) games. This is a work in progress, wasn't tested in mobile devices yet. **For the simple version, follow this article on Medium: https://medium.com/@larissaredeker/3d-character-customization-fd95a1d57ae** **3D Models** All the 3d models used here are in FBX format in the Assets folder. The original files in Blender (2.77) format can be found in the Source Models Files folder. **Important Notes** All data used by the asset is stored in a database. In the actual version, the database is a set of XML files. Implementations to use another way to store the necessary data can be easily implemented, check the Documentation for more info.
